我的构建中有 ant-1.7.0.jar 和 ant-1.6.2.jar,这是破坏性测试。查看 ivy:report,似乎 1.6.2 被解析为 ant#ant,而 1.7 被解析为 ant#org.apache.ant。
那么如何配置 Ivy 将 ant 和 org.apache.ant 视为同一个组织呢?
我的构建中有 ant-1.7.0.jar 和 ant-1.6.2.jar,这是破坏性测试。查看 ivy:report,似乎 1.6.2 被解析为 ant#ant,而 1.7 被解析为 ant#org.apache.ant。
那么如何配置 Ivy 将 ant 和 org.apache.ant 视为同一个组织呢?
你不能,但你可以创建一个全局排除:
<ivy-module version="2.0">
..
..
<dependencies>
..
..
<!-- Global exclusions -->
<exclude org="ant" module="ant"/>
</dependencies>
</ivy-module>